Tagged 1v1 Games

1v1 games focus on direct competition between two participants. Typically the core objective is to reduce an opponent's resources or health to zero first. The genre often features symmetric character abilities or mirrored starting conditions to ensure fairness. Steadily use the established control scheme to execute actions and defeat the opponent.


The core loop involves managing a limited set of resources while predicting the opponent's moves to secure an advantage. Matches are usually short and require constant attention to spacing and timing to avoid taking damage. Successful players learn to recognize patterns in the opponent's behavior and adapt their own approach accordingly. This dynamic defines the essence of competitive fighting games where every moment counts. The experience is defined by fast exchanges and the need to execute precise moves under pressure.
